Didn’t catch the full ceremony last night? Not to worry. Here is a rundown of the highlights of the 2019 Oscars.

Spike Lee Finally Wins an Oscar

Spike Lee finally receives an Oscar for Best Adapted Screenplay and looks more excited than a child at Christmas when his name is called.

Olivia Coleman’s Charming Acceptance Speech

Olivia Coleman was totally overwhelmed when she had to give a speech for her Best Actress Award. Watching the former Peep Show star blow a raspberry when told to wrap her speech up is gold.

A Netflix Film Finally Got Industry Recognition

It’s no secret that the film industry is unwelcoming to original films from streaming platforms. Cannes even banned Netflix from participating in the festival last year. Mexican film Roma picked up multiple awards indicating that the Academy favors epic direction over trendy snobbery.

Lady Gaga and Bradley Cooper Perform “Shallow”

There many superb performances at last night’s ceremony but best of all has got to be Oscar-winning Lady Gaga and Bradley Cooper’s performance of “Shallow” from their movie.

Rami Malik Wins Another Award For Bohemian Rhapsody

Rami Malek has won a Golden Globe, a BAFTA and a SAGA for his incredible performance as Freddie Mercury in Bohemian Rhapsody. Now, he has added an Oscar to his collection and his acceptance speech was as charming and humble as ever.

Melissa McCarthy and Brian Tyree Henry’s Wacky Costumes

Lady Gaga may have dressed in diamonds but this The Favourite and Mary Poppins inspired look takes the cake.

Lady Gaga

Lady Gaga looked sensational as always. To top off her look, the singer song-writer wore a 128 carat Tiffany’s diamond, one of the biggest in the world. The diamond was previously worn by Audrey Hepburn in Breakfast At Tiffany’s.

Its official: the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ences has reversed its controversial decision to relegate four categories to commercial breaks. 

The winners of Cinematography, Editing, Make-Up and Hairstyling and Live Action Short awards will now be awarded during the live telecast, Deadline confirms. The decision was made by Academy president John Bailey and CEO Dawn Hudson.

“The Academy has heard the feedback from its membership regarding the Oscar presentation of four awards – Cinematography, Film Editing, Live Action Short, and Makeup and Hairstyling. All Academy Awards will be presented without edits, in our traditional format. We look forward to Oscar Sunday, February 24,” an Academy statement said.

The initial decision was criticized by a slew of Hollywood A-listers including Brad Pitt, Russell Crowe, George Clooney, Quentin Tarantino, Guillermo del Toro and more.

It looks like that at least this time, common sense prevailed. 

The 91st Academy Awards take place Sunday February 24, at the Dolby Theatre, Los Angeles, California.

The Oscar nominations for 2019 have finally been announced and The Favourite, Bohemian Rhapsody, A Star As Born and Black Panther have received the well-deserved recognition we anticipated.

Without further ado, here is the full list of all the nominees in every category.

BEST PICTURE:

Black Panther

BlacKkKlansman

Bohemian Rhapsody

The Favourite

Green Book

Roma

A Star Is Born

Vice

LEAD ACTOR:

Christian Bale, Vice

Bradley Cooper, A Star Is Born

Willem Dafoe, At Eternity’s Gate

Rami Malek, Bohemian Rhapsody

Viggo Mortensen, Green Book

LEAD ACTRESS:

Yalitza Aparicio, Roma

Glenn Close, The Wife

Olivia Colman, The Favourite

Lady Gaga, A Star Is Born

Melissa McCarthy, Can You Ever Forgive Me?

SUPPORTING ACTOR:

Mahershala Ali, Green Book

Adam Driver, BlacKkKlansman

Sam Elliott, A Star Is Born

Richard E. Grant, Can You Ever Forgive Me?

Sam Rockwell, Vice

SUPPORTING ACTRESS:

Amy Adams, Vice

Marina de Tavira, Roma

Regina King, If Beale Street Could Talk

Emma Stone, The Favourite

Rachel Weisz, The Favourite

DIRECTOR:

Spike Lee, BlacKkKlansman

Pawel Pawlikowski, Cold War

Yorgos Lanthimos, The Favourite

Alfonso Cuarón, Roma

Adam McKay, Vice

ANIMATED FEATURE:

Incredibles 2, Brad Bird

Isle Of Dogs, Wes Anderson

Mirai, Mamoru Hosoda

Ralph Breaks The Internet, Rich Moore, Phil Johnston

Spider-Man: Into The Spider-Verse, Bob Persichetti, Peter Ramsey, Rodney Rothman

ANIMATED SHORT:

Animal Behaviour, Alison Snowden, David Fine

Bao, Domee Shi

Late Afternoon, Louise Bagnall

One Small Step, Andrew Chesworth, Bobby Pontillas

Weekends, Trevor Jimenez

ADAPTED SCREENPLAY:

The Ballad Of Buster Scruggs, Joel Coen, Ethan Coen

BlacKkKlansman, Charlie Wachtel, David Rabinowitz, Kevin Willmott, Spike Lee

Can You Ever Forgive Me?, Nicole Holofcener and Jeff Whitty

If Beale Street Could Talk, Barry Jenkins

A Star Is Born, Eric Roth, Bradley Cooper, Will Fetters

ORIGINAL SCREENPLAY:

The Favourite, Deborah Davis, Tony McNamara

First Reformed, Paul Schrader

Green Book, Nick Vallelonga, Brian Currie, Peter Farrelly

Roma, Alfonso Cuarón

Vice, Adam McKay

CINEMATOGRAPHY:

Cold War, Lukasz Zal

The Favourite, Robbie Ryan

Never Look Away, Caleb Deschanel

Roma, Alfonso Cuarón

A Star Is Born, Matthew Libatique

BEST DOCUMENTARY FEATURE:

Free Solo, Jimmy Chin, Elizabeth Chai Vasarhelyi

Hale County This Morning, This Evening, RaMell Ross

Minding the Gap, Bing Liu

Of Fathers And Sons, Talal Derki

RBG, Betsy West, Julie Cohen

BEST DOCUMENTARY SHORT SUBJECT:

Black Sheep, Ed Perkins

End Game, Rob Epstein, Jeffrey Friedman

Lifeboat, Skye Fitzgerald

A Night At The Garden, Marshall Curry

Period. End Of Sentence., Rayka Zehtabchi

BEST LIVE ACTION SHORT FILM:

Detainment, Vincent Lambe

Fauve, Jeremy Comte

Marguerite, Marianne Farley

Mother, Rodrigo Sorogoyen

Skin, Guy Nattiv

BEST FOREIGN LANGUAGE FILM:

Capernaum (Lebanon)

Cold War (Poland)

Never Look Away (Germany)

Roma (Mexico)

Shoplifters (Japan)

FILM EDITING:

BlacKkKlansman, Barry Alexander Brown

Bohemian Rhapsody, John Ottman

Green Book, Patrick J. Don Vito

The Favourite, Yorgos Mavropsaridis

Vice, Hank Corwin

SOUND EDITING:

Black Panther, Benjamin A. Burtt, Steve Boeddeker

Bohemian Rhapsody, John Warhurst

First Man, Ai-Ling Lee, Mildred Iatrou Morgan

A Quiet Place, Ethan Van der Ryn, Erik Aadahl

Roma, Sergio Diaz, Skip Lievsay

SOUND MIXING:

Black Panther

Bohemian Rhapsody

First Man

Roma

A Star Is Born

PRODUCTION DESIGN:

Black Panther, Hannah Beachler

First Man, Nathan Crowley, Kathy Lucas

The Favourite, Fiona Crombie, Alice Felton

Mary Poppins Returns, John Myhre, Gordon Sim

Roma, Eugenio Caballero, Bárbara Enrı́quez

ORIGINAL SCORE:

BlacKkKlansman, Terence Blanchard

Black Panther, Ludwig Goransson

If Beale Street Could Talk, Nicholas Britell

Isle Of Dogs, Alexandre Desplat

Mary Poppins Returns, Marc Shaiman, Scott Wittman

ORIGINAL SONG:

All The Stars from Black Panther by Kendrick Lamar, SZA

I’ll Fight from RBG by Diane Warren, Jennifer Hudson

The Place Where Lost Things Go from Mary Poppins Returns by Marc Shaiman, Scott Wittman

Shallow from A Star Is Born by Lady Gaga, Mark Ronson, Anthony Rossomando, Andrew Wyatt and Benjamin Rice

When A Cowboy Trades His Spurs For Wings from The Ballad Of Buster Scruggs by David Rawlings and Gillian Welch

MAKEUP AND HAIR:

Border

Mary Queen Of Scots

Vice

COSTUME DESIGN:

The Ballad Of Buster Scruggs, Mary Zophres

Black Panther, Ruth E. Carter

The Favourite, Sandy Powell

Mary Poppins Returns, Sandy Powell

Mary Queen Of Scots, Alexandra Byrne

VISUAL EFFECTS:

Avengers: Infinity War

Christopher Robin

First Man

Ready Player One

Solo: A Star Wars Story
